Functions must separate pleads Robertshaw
A report has highlighted 'serious failings' in the Department of Environment, Food and Agriculture's role as both promoter and regulator of Manx produce.
It says these functions should be separated and has called on the Council of Ministers to consider the issue.
Manx Radio has contacted government for a response.
Douglas East MHK Chris Robertshaw is on the the Tynwald committee which has produced reports into DEFA's involvement in the dairy sector and the meat plant.
